Here is a full install guide/tutorial for the aftermarket Woodsport BC front lip on a mk1b MR2. It includes fitting, drilling, bolting, mounting, and painting.

Hardware? Like the bolts and bracket? Just went to any hardware store and grabbed some. Technically I brought a bolt off my fender to match it at the store but it really doesn’t matter if the size and thread are different since they are completely separate. All the stuff should only cost a few bucks.
